Political prisoner Zmitser Furmanau kept in punishment cell in Vitsebsk colony for about 40 days


Upon his arrival in penal colony Nr 3 in Vitsebsk region (Vitsba-3), political prisoner Zmitser Furmanau was never sent to his detachment.

After being in quarantine, he was immediately put in punitive confinement. The inmate is still being held there.

Furmanau has not been released from a disciplinary cell, moreover, he has been placed there again for several days for unknown reasons, the Telegram channel They Have A Right has reported on Friday. According to human rights centre Viasna, Furmanau has been kept there for 38 days. Last week, the prisoner’s relatives asked for people’s support and spreading information about his situation.

Hrodna resident Dzmitry (Zmitser) Furmanau was detained on 29 May 2020 during a picket to collect signatures for the nomination of Svyatlana Tsikhanouskaya as a candidate for presidency; he was a regional coordinator of the team. On the same day Svyatlana’s husband Syarhei Tsikhanouski and his associates were arrested.

Furmanau was charged under Part 1 Article 342 (‘organisation and preparation of actions that grossly violate public order’) of the Criminal Code. He was awaiting the trial in the Hrodna prison, where he was repeatedly placed in solitary confinement. Judge Volha Bekushava sentenced him to two years of imprisonment in a minimum security penal colony.

The Belarusian human rights community recognised Zmitser Furmanau as a political prisoner.
